🏏Australia defeated Sri Lanka by two wickets in a rain-hit first ODI in Pallekele.
Chasing a target of 301, Australia were 72 for two at one stage before rain had interrupted proceedings. The play resumed with an improvised target of 282 runs in 44 overs, but Australia chased it down with nine balls to spare, thanks to fifties from Glenn Maxwell and Steve Smith.
Maxwell top-scored with an unbeaten 80 while Smith returned to form with a fine 53 off 60 deliveries.
Earlier, Wicketkeeper Kushal Mendis anchored Sri Lanka's batting performance to help their team reach 300-7 against Australia in Tuesday's first one-day international.

⚽️ Qatar Quest Complete: Socceroos Secure Qualification To Fifth Consecutive FIFA World Cup™
As you know by now, Australia beat Peru 5-4 on penalties in an intercontinental play-off to qualify for the 2022 World Cup in Qatar.
Australia became the 31st team to book their place at the 2022 World Cup after beating Peru on penalties in an intercontinental play-off in Qatar.
Goalkeeper Andrew Redmayne, who replaced Mat Ryan just before the shootout for his third cap, was the hero, saving Alex Valera's final kick.
This will be Australia's fifth World Cup in a row, having qualified every time since 2006.
They will be in Group D alongside holders France, Denmark, and Tunisia.
"I knew I was going to score. It was the only way to say thank you to Australia, from me and my family.
“My family fled Sudan because of war, I was born in a hut. For Australia to take us in and re-settle us, it gave me and my family a chance of life." - Awer Mabil.
🏉 Barnstorming Wests Tigers backrower Luciano Leilua has quit the club immediately to join an NRL rival.
Leilua will head to North Queensland, having already signed a three-year deal to join the Cowboys for season 2023.
"We wish Luciano the very best with his future," Tigers CEO Justin Pascoe said.

🐴 Nature Strip, the first Australian-trained victor at Royal Ascot since Black Caviar in 2012, won by four and a half lengths from Twilight Calls with 200-1 shot Acklam Express and Mooneista close up in third and fourth respectively.
"It's pretty special to bring a horse all this way and compete against the best in the world and to win the way he did. It was breathtaking," said Chris Waller, who also trained record-breaking mare Winx.

🐴 Baaeed and Coroebus were the other big winners on a thrilling opening day at Royal Ascot.
Baaeed extended his unbeaten run to eight in the Queen Anne Stakes, while 2,000 Guineas winner Coroebus landed the St James's Palace Stakes.
The world's top-rated horse Baaeed got the meeting off to a brilliant start with a classy win in the Queen Anne Stakes.
The four-year-old, with Jim Crowley riding for trainer William Haggas, beat Real World by one and three quarter lengths.
Baaeed, sent off as the 1.15 favourite, justified his short odds.
"It doesn't get any easier than that. Everything went like clockwork," said Crowley.
"It's the pinnacle. You could spend your whole life waiting for a horse like this to come along."

🏏 Jonny Bairstow's astonishing century led England to a stunning win in the second Test against New Zealand which sealed a series victory.
On a breathless final day at Trent Bridge, Bairstow made the second-fastest century by an England batter in Test cricket as the hosts strolled to what should have been a challenging target of 299 from 72 overs.
Bairstow's outrageous hitting in the spell after tea took him to three figures from 77 balls, only just missing the England record of 76 balls that has stood for 120 years.

🎾 American tennis legend Serena Williams has revealed she'll return from her lengthy injury break to chase glory at this year's edition of Wimbledon, set to begin on June 27.
The 40-year-old will compete on the WTA tour for the first time since last year's Wimbledon tournament.
⚽️ The possible introduction of kick-ins has been discussed at the latest meeting of football's lawmaking body.
The International Football Association Board (Ifab) held its annual general meeting in Doha on Monday.
Former Arsenal manager Arsene Wenger, head of global development for world governing body Fifa, included the idea among several new proposals last year.
